Abstract
Despite the emergence of XML as a standard for data exchange on the Web, XML update processing has received little attention. One of the issues that need to be addressed in XML update processing is the update robustness of the XML numbering scheme employed for efficient containment query processing. In this paper, we propose an efficient update robust XML numbering scheme. It works for both ordered and unordered XML data and fits well in XML to relational mapping. The proposed scheme was implemented with a relational database as the XML stores. The experimental results showed that our scheme is more efficient than the previous one.
